STS-48
Launch: September 12, 1991
Landing: September 18, 1991 Edwards Air Force Base, Cal.
Astronauts: John O. Creighton, Kenneth S. Reightler, Jr., Mark N. Brown, Charles D. Gemar and James F. Buchli
Space Shuttle: Discovery
The primary payload, the Upper Atmosphere Research Satellite (UARS), was deployed on the third day of the mission. It was used to study the Earth’s troposphere.
